Job Description
Partner Program Manager leading RepairPal pilot rollouts, partner execution, and performance reporting. Supporting Yelp’s automotive repair marketplace through strategic integrations and monetization.
Responsibilities:
- Engage directly with business partners and consumers to identify market needs and drive measurable business outcomes through strategic partnerships
- Manage partner execution across pilots, test programs, and full launches, ensuring milestones and momentum
- Establish operating cadences for launched partners, including bi-weekly check-ins and quarterly business reviews
- Serve as a point of contact for referral partners, driving alignment and accelerating program execution
- Build and maintain project plans, contact lists, and reporting schedules
- Define success metrics and deliver actionable performance reporting
- Champion partner needs cross-functionally and prioritize partner-related features and initiatives
- Evaluate program progress and communicate with internal and external stakeholders
- Develop and improve processes, tools, and documentation
- Develop a deep understanding of RepairPal's monetization systems to ensure referrals are accurately tracked and monetized
- Travel as required, up to 50%
Requirements:
- 3–5 years of experience managing strategic accounts, partners, programs, or projects
- Experience in or passion for the automotive industry and auto-related technology is a bonus
- Comfortable with up to 50% travel across the US
- Ability to manage multiple projects, stakeholders, and deliverables simultaneously
- Strong strategic planning and execution skills with a track record of driving results
- Excellent verbal and written communication skills
- Experience building reports and deriving actionable insights from data
- High level of professionalism, integrity, and business maturity
- Self-motivated, assertive, and energetic, with enthusiasm and follow-through
- Naturally curious about systems, products, and businesses
- Proficiency with CRM tools; HubSpot experience is a plus
